Check Digit Verification of cas no

The CAS Registry Mumber 887338-40-1 includes 9 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 6 digits, 8,8,7,3,3 and 8 respectively; the second part has 2 digits, 4 and 0 respectively.
Calculate Digit Verification of CAS Registry Number 887338-40:
(8*8)+(7*8)+(6*7)+(5*3)+(4*3)+(3*8)+(2*4)+(1*0)=221
221 % 10 = 1
So 887338-40-1 is a valid CAS Registry Number.

Synthesis and biological evaluation of novel C-indolylxylosides as sodium-dependent glucose co-transporter 2 inhibitors

Yao, Chun-Hsu,Song, Jen-Shin,Chen, Chiung-Tong,Yeh, Teng-Kuang,Hsieh, Tsung-Chih,Wu, Szu-Huei,Huang, Chung-Yu,Huang, Yu-Lin,Wang, Min-Hsien,Liu, Yu-Wei,Tsai, Chi-Hui,Kumar, Chidambaram Ramesh,Lee, Jinq-Chyi

, p. 32 - 38,7 (2020/07/31)

Sodium-dependent glucose co-transporter 2 (SGLT2) inhibitors are the current focus on the indication for the management of hyperglycemia in diabetes. Here, a novel series of C-linked indolylxyloside-based inhibitors of SGLT2 has been discovered. Structure-activity relationship studies revealed that substituents at the 7-position of the indole moiety and a p-cyclopropylphenyl group in the distal position were necessary for optimum inhibitory activity. The pharmacokinetic study demonstrates that the most potent compound 1i is metabolically stable with a low clearance in rats. In further efficacy study, 1i is found to significantly lower blood glucose levels of streptozotocin (STZ)-induced diabetic rats.
